Greensboro, NC (February 8, 2025) – A collision involving a school bus and a passenger vehicle was reported on Reidsville Rd, resulting in injuries on Friday.
According to local reports, emergency crews were called to the scene to assist those involved in the crash. Two individuals sustained injuries and were transported to a nearby hospital for medical treatment. The identities of those injured and the extent of their injuries have not yet been released.
First responders, including paramedics and fire crews, worked to assist those suffering from injuries after the collision. Law enforcement officials arrived to investigate the crash and determine its cause.
Authorities have not disclosed whether students were on the school bus at the time of the accident. Investigators continue to assess the circumstances leading up to the crash. Updates will be provided as new information becomes available. Our thoughts are with those affected by this accident.
School Bus Accidents in North Carolina
School bus accidents, while less frequent than other types of crashes, can have severe consequences, especially when children are involved. North Carolina roads, including Reidsville Rd, experience heavy traffic, and factors such as driver distraction, adverse weather conditions, and failure to yield contribute to bus-related collisions.
According to data from the North Carolina Department of Transportation (NCDOT), dozens of school bus-related crashes occur across the state each year, with many leading to injuries. These accidents can cause significant physical, emotional, and financial hardships for those involved.
